Have you tried VW. See if they have the code for the key, if so they can make you one. it'll be expensive.
-
Yeah I did mate, Ta.
10 days to order the key from Germany + the car has to be at the nearest dealer for coding which is 30 miles away.
didn't fancy the wait and cost of a low loader + 20 for key + 65 for coding. Wife needs her car on tuesday
SO, just bought me a new ecu, handles, transponder, key and ignition barrel. 85 delivered.
Hope it does the job, don't want to give up on the old girl yet.
